Crockett Block

1883, Alfred Giles; 1985 restoration, Humberto Saldana and Associates. 317–323 Alamo Plaza

Along the original west wall of the Alamo compound is a unified quartet of three-story Italianate buildings with metal cornices that were built for William and Albert Maverick. The buildings' facades make use of ornamental cast-iron shop fronts, with carefully cut limestone on the second and third floors. The rough-cut stones of the south wall reveal the typical local vernacular German masonry, which had a coarser character than the dressed limestone of the facades.
